Barcelona Preparing Big Money Move For Nigeria Winger Targeted by Liverpool, Man City
Published: May 13, 2019
Spanish champions Barcelona are lining up a sensational move for Nigeria wonderkid Samuel Chhukwueze, according to reports emanating from Spain.
Don Balon claims the La Liga giants have decided to do away with the services of Brazil star Philippe Coutinho, who has struggled to live up to expectations since a big money move from Liverpool in January 2018.
The Blaugrana have made Villarreal winger Chukwueze their top target this summer in the event that Coutinho departs the Camp Nou.
The Nigerian winger commands a transfer fee in the region of 60 million euros and is also on the radar of Premier League duo Liverpool and Manchester City.
Villarreal are hoping to offer Chukwueze a new deal but little progress has been made as he doesn't want his market value to increase.
He has scored 8 goals for Villarreal's first team this season, including his strike against Barcelona last month.
Former Nigeria internationals Emmanuel Amunike and Gbenga Okunowo made appearances for Barcelona's first team before hanging up their boots and Chukwueze could follow in their footsteps if the transfer materializes.
